Jewish students in York have refused to sign a joint statement with their university over their complaints of antisemitism , as they claim it does not acknowledge the issue properly.

Members of the York University Jewish Society met officials from the university on Monday to discuss their complaints over the performance at York of the play Seven Jewish Children, which has been described as antisemitic.

JSoc member Zachary Confino attended the meeting. He said a draft statement from the university did not mention the play and only spoke about the future without acknowledging the difficulties Jewish students had experienced.

“What they are trying to do is white-wash everything and smooth over their media image,” said the 21-year-old.
